The last and best AGP 8x GPU made was an ATI Radeon HD4670, though they haven't been manufactured for about 6 or 7 years. You'll need to search eBay etc to find one. I'd also check the size to see if it fits.

Now that said, what games do you plan on playing? because even with that 4670 your options for anything newer than around 4 years ago are quite limited.
